6-ft-long rat snake found in COVID quarantine centre

Jul 09, 2020

Agra (UP), Jul 10 (ANI): A 6-foot-long rat snake was found in a COVID quarantine centre on July 09. The rescue team reached the spot to get hold of the creature. Team left the snake in its natural habitat. Wildlife SOS Conservation Project Director said, "Today we got the information that Hindustan college which has been turned into a quarantine centre, a big snake was found within the centre. Our rescue team reached the spot and it was a 6 foot rattle snake. We have safely left the snake in its habitat."
